

Meljo Thomas Karakunnel, a PhD in Journalism, is a media professional and an academic interested in environmental communication, media ecology, media freedom, and communication for SDGs and and the intersection of media with human rights. He serves as the Head of the Department of Media Studies at CHRIST University, Bangalore. He is also the Project Director of the Climate Change Reporting Workshop, supported by the Fulbright-Hays U.S. Grant, which focuses on training journalists in climate communication. He has organized major national and international conferences, including the National Mass Communication Research Conference and Media Meet, along with seminars, workshops, and cultural festivals on music and millets, supported by government and NGO bodies.
Designed and launched the Undergraduate Journalism programme in alignment with the Indian National Education Policy (NEP) 2020.
Led the revision of the Journalism, Psychology, and English (JPE) curriculum in collaboration with industry professionals and academic experts.
Organised workshops and seminars aimed at equipping students with industry-relevant skills and knowledge.
